Description

In the field of sociocultural and community services, it is necessary to know the different fields of promotion for effective equality between women and men, within the professional area of ​​training and education. Thus, this course aims to provide the necessary knowledge to promote and maintain communication channels in the intervention environment, incorporating the gender perspective.

Job opportunities

He carries out his professional activity as an employee in the public and private spheres, in collaboration with the intervention team and under the direct supervision of the competent person at a higher level. Likewise, it detects situations of inequality and the needs derived from it, organizing and transferring relevant information in the field of its specialty, both to the reference population and to higher-level professionals, to promote and guide actions regarding effective equality between women and men, and prevent discrimination against the female population. In the development of professional activity, the principles of universal accessibility are applied in accordance with current legislation.

What does it prepare you for?

This training conforms to the training itinerary of the Training Module MF1453_3 Communication with a Gender Perspective, certifying that you have passed the different Units of Competence included in them, and is aimed at the accreditation of the professional Competencies acquired through work experience and non-formal training, through which you will be eligible to obtain the corresponding Certificate of Professionalism, through the respective calls published by the different Autonomous Communities, as well as the Ministry of Labor itself (Royal Decree 659/2023, of July 18, which develops the organization of the Vocational Training System and establishes a permanent procedure for the accreditation of professional skills acquired through work experience or non-formal training).

Objectives

- Collect information in the intervention environment to diagnose situations of discrimination based on sex, ensuring that it is useful and verified. - Transfer the initial diagnosis of discrimination situations to the competent higher-level professional, including, from a gender perspective, the structural problems detected that are useful, to achieve an analysis of reality coordinated with the intervention team. - Create communication supports in different formats (bibliographic, audiovisual, digital, among others), ensuring a non-sexist or discriminatory use of language, selecting and preparing the necessary information and keeping it updated, to allow responding to the information needs demanded by the intervention environment. - Establish stable communication channels with the target population, keeping them open and verifying their usefulness, to involve them in the actions that are developed and guarantee permanent adaptation to their needs. - Inform and advise on access and use of existing resources in the intervention environment, selecting them based on the demands of each user to provide an individualized response to their needs. - Detect and collect information and resources from the equality institutions and organizations that exist in the intervention environment to make them available to the target population. - Detect and communicate the reproduction of sexist and discriminatory stereotypes in language, in the treatment of images and in the actions of the intervention environment, following established protocols and pathways, to eradicate discrimination based on sex.
